myisam表锁问题
我.知道myisam会给所有需要用到的表加锁,那么我用join或union也会一次给所有涉及到的表枷锁吗
[解决办法]
select 的时候如果没加 for update不会加锁。
如果是 update a inner join b set 则会都加。
[解决办法]
查询select没有更新update的话一般不会加锁的。
如果update的话会加锁的。
发布时间: 2012-03-08 13:30:13 作者: rapoo
myisam表锁问题
我.知道myisam会给所有需要用到的表加锁,那么我用join或union也会一次给所有涉及到的表枷锁吗
[解决办法]
select 的时候如果没加 for update不会加锁。
如果是 update a inner join b set 则会都加。
[解决办法]
查询select没有更新update的话一般不会加锁的。
如果update的话会加锁的。